Maine Coon Cats are really Skogkatts

From the page at http://www.3quarksdaily.com/3quarksdaily/2012/01/will-the-maine-coon-become-an-american-icon.html

There are three popular, believable Maine Coon creation myths. (There is a fourth anatomically impossible story about Maine Coons evolving from raccoons.) [ French and English fantasies deleted] The last story traces the Coon’s lineage back to the Vikings. When the Norsemen sailed to America in the 11th Century they brought Skogkatts – Norwegian Forest Cats – along with them as mousers, some of whom, like their marauding owners, forced themselves upon the native population, creating the first batch of Maine Coon kittens.

How long does it take kittens’ eyes to open?

It takes 5-8 days for a short-haired kitten to open her eyes. It takes 10-14 days for a long-haired kitten. It’s another week after that before they focus well enough to see and navigate.

Cats with Odd Colored Eyes


Odd-eyed white cats, unlike white cats with two blues eyes, are usually not deaf.

TSA Regulations for traveling with cats

TSA security procedures do not prohibit you from bringing a pet on your flight. You should contact your airline or travel agent, however, before arriving at the airport to determine your airline’s policy on traveling with pets.

Security Screening

You will need to present the animal to the Security Officers at the checkpoint. You may walk your animal through the metal detector with you. If this is not possible, your animal will have to undergo a secondary screening, including a visual and physical inspection by our Security Officers.

Your animal will NEVER be placed through an X-ray machine. However, you may be asked to remove your animal from its carrier so that the carrier can be placed on the X-Ray machine.

Transformed by the Power of Love


When people are truly in love, they experience far more than just a mutual need of each other’s company and consolation. In their relations with each other they become different people: they are more than their everyday selves, more alive, more understanding, more enduring… They are made over into new beings. They are transformed by the power of their love.

Love is the revelation of our deepest personal meaning, value and identity. But this revelation remains impossible as long as we are the prisoners of our own egoism. I cannot find myself in myself, but only in another. My true meaning and worth are shown to me not in my estimate of myself, but in the eyes of the one who loves me; and that one must love me as I am, with my faults and limitations, revealing to me the truth that these faults and limitations cannot destroy my worth in the eyes of that one who loves me; and that I am therefore valuable as a person, in spite of my shortcomings, in spite of the imperfections of my exterior “package.” The package is totally unimportant. What matters is this infinitely precious message which I can discover only in my love for another person. And this message, this secret, is not fully revealed to me unless at the same time I am able to see and understand the mysterious and unique worth of the one I love.

~Thomas Merton, Love and Living

Cats, Cat Barf and Daisies

Chrysanthemums (they *look* like daisies) are toxic to cats. Common garden daisies, and gerbera daisies are not, although eating them may cause your cat to vomit. Cats will eat grass and other greens in order to rid themselves of furballs.
